Town: Located in Suffolk, England, between the towns of Lavenham and Long Melford, Glemsford is a picture-perfect English village. Famous for its ancient listed buildings, the village also has two friendly pubs (Angel Inn and Black Lion), two take-out restaurants, and a fully stocked convenience store. Gainsborough's House, the Sudbury Heritage Centre, the Sudbury Water Meadows, Belle Vue Park, and the restaurants White Horse, The Boathouse Bar and Grill, and The Secret Garden are just a few of the attractions and conveniences waiting for you in Sudbury. Just outside of town is Melford Hall, a lovely National Trust site that was previously held by Beatrix Potter's family. Bury St. Edmunds comes up next, and it has a spectacular abbey and cathedral in addition to Moyse's Hall Museum and the Museum of the Suffolk Regiment.
